Accès au courrier électronique de l'utilisateur via l'API Facebook Graph

Accès au courrier électronique de l'utilisateur via l'API Facebook Graph
API de graphique Facebook

Déverrouiller les données utilisateur avec l'API Graph de Facebook

L'exploration des profondeurs de l'API Graph de Facebook révèle un trésor de données, prêt à être exploité par les développeurs cherchant à améliorer l'expérience utilisateur. Au cœur de cette exploration se trouve la quête d’obtention des e-mails des utilisateurs, une information essentielle pour la personnalisation et la communication. L'API Graph, avec ses vastes capacités, offre un chemin direct vers ces données, à condition de respecter les autorisations et les politiques de confidentialité nécessaires. Comprendre les mécanismes derrière ces appels d'API est essentiel pour tirer parti du vaste réseau de Facebook au profit de vos applications.

Le parcours pour accéder aux e-mails des utilisateurs via l’API Facebook Graph n’est pas seulement une question d’exécution technique ; il s'agit de comprendre la symbiose entre la confidentialité des utilisateurs et les besoins des développeurs. Avec la bonne approche, les développeurs peuvent débloquer une mine d’informations qui peuvent être utilisées pour créer des expériences utilisateur plus attrayantes et personnalisées. Cependant, le chemin est semé d'embûches, notamment celui de s'adapter aux politiques de confidentialité rigoureuses de Facebook et d'assurer leur conformité à chaque étape. Cette introduction sert de passerelle pour comprendre comment exploiter la puissance de l'API Graph pour atteindre vos objectifs de développement.

Pourquoi les squelettes ne se battent-ils pas ? Ils n’ont pas le courage.

Commande Description
GET /v12.0/me?fields=email Requête API pour récupérer l'adresse e-mail de l'utilisateur, en supposant que les autorisations nécessaires ont été accordées.
access_token Le jeton qui accorde l'accès à l'API Facebook Graph, généralement obtenu après l'authentification de l'utilisateur.

Plonger plus profondément dans la récupération d'e-mails de l'API Facebook Graph

Récupérer l'adresse e-mail d'un utilisateur à l'aide de l'API Facebook Graph est un processus qui repose sur la compréhension des politiques de confidentialité strictes de Facebook et des nuances techniques de l'API elle-même. L'API Graph sert de fenêtre sur les vastes données détenues par Facebook, mais l'accès à ces données nécessite le consentement explicite de l'utilisateur. Ce consentement est généralement obtenu via le processus d'autorisation OAuth 2.0, dans lequel les utilisateurs accordent des autorisations aux applications pour accéder à des types d'informations spécifiques, tels que leur adresse e-mail. Les développeurs doivent concevoir leurs applications pour demander cette autorisation d'une manière claire et transparente pour les utilisateurs, en garantissant que la demande d'accès aux informations personnelles est justifiée par la fonctionnalité de l'application.

Une fois l'autorisation accordée, les développeurs peuvent appeler l'API Graph, en particulier le point de terminaison qui récupère les informations de profil utilisateur, y compris l'adresse e-mail. Cela nécessite une compréhension de la gestion des versions de l'API, car Facebook met périodiquement à jour son API, modifiant potentiellement la manière dont les données sont accessibles ou les autorisations requises. De plus, il ne faut pas trop insister sur la gestion responsable des données une fois reçues, compte tenu du climat actuel en matière de confidentialité des données. Les développeurs doivent s'assurer qu'ils respectent toutes les réglementations pertinentes en matière de protection des données, telles que le RGPD en Europe, qui impose des directives strictes sur la manière dont les données personnelles sont collectées, traitées et stockées. La complexité de ces considérations souligne l’importance d’aborder la récupération des e-mails avec une stratégie globale qui équilibre l’expérience utilisateur, la confidentialité et la conformité réglementaire.

Récupération du courrier électronique de l'utilisateur via l'API Facebook Graph

Utiliser JavaScript avec le SDK Facebook

FB.init({
  appId      : 'your-app-id',
  cookie     : true,
  xfbml      : true,
  version    : 'v12.0'
});

FB.login(function(response) {
  if (response.authResponse) {
     console.log('Welcome!  Fetching your information.... ');
     FB.api('/me', {fields: 'email'}, function(response) {
       console.log('Good to see you, ' + response.email + '.');
     });
  } else {
     console.log('User cancelled login or did not fully authorize.');
  }
}, {scope: 'email'});

Navigation dans la récupération d'e-mails avec l'API Facebook Graph

Au cœur de l'utilisation de l'API Facebook Graph pour récupérer les e-mails des utilisateurs se trouve l'équilibre délicat entre les besoins des développeurs et la confidentialité des utilisateurs. Cet équilibre est régi par le système d'autorisations de Facebook, qui oblige les utilisateurs à accorder explicitement aux applications l'autorisation d'accéder à leurs adresses e-mail. Le processus fait partie intégrante de la garantie que les utilisateurs conservent le contrôle de leurs données personnelles tout en permettant aux développeurs de créer des expériences personnalisées et engageantes. Les développeurs doivent naviguer dans ce paysage avec une compréhension approfondie à la fois des aspects techniques de l'API et des implications éthiques de l'accès aux données.

De plus, l'évolution de l'API Facebook Graph, avec ses mises à jour régulières et ses changements de version, pose un défi permanent aux développeurs. Chaque version peut introduire de nouvelles fonctionnalités, en déprécier d'autres ou modifier les autorisations d'accès, obligeant les développeurs à rester informés et à adapter leurs applications en conséquence. Cet environnement dynamique souligne l’importance d’une conception d’applications robustes, où l’anticipation des changements et la mise en œuvre de pratiques compatibles avec le futur deviennent primordiales. De plus, les développeurs doivent également tenir compte du paysage mondial des réglementations sur la confidentialité des données, en s'assurant que leurs applications sont conformes dans différentes juridictions, ce qui complique encore davantage le processus de récupération des e-mails mais garantit une interaction plus sûre et plus respectueuse avec les données des utilisateurs.

Foire aux questions sur la récupération d'e-mails de l'API Facebook Graph

  1. Question: N'importe quelle application peut-elle récupérer les e-mails des utilisateurs via l'API Facebook Graph ?
  2. Répondre: Seules les applications qui ont reçu le consentement explicite de l'utilisateur pour accéder au champ de messagerie peuvent récupérer les e-mails des utilisateurs. Cela se fait via le système d'autorisation OAuth.
  3. Question: Ai-je besoin d’autorisations spéciales pour accéder aux e-mails des utilisateurs ?
  4. Répondre: Oui, vous devez demander et obtenir l'autorisation « e-mail » des utilisateurs pendant le processus de connexion OAuth.
  5. Question: Comment gérer les modifications dans les versions de l'API ?
  6. Répondre: Les développeurs doivent régulièrement consulter la documentation de l'API de Facebook pour connaître les changements de version et ajuster leurs applications pour se conformer aux nouvelles exigences et aux dépréciations.
  7. Question: Est-il possible de récupérer les emails des utilisateurs qui n'ont pas utilisé mon application ?
  8. Répondre: Non, vous ne pouvez récupérer que les adresses e-mail des utilisateurs qui se sont connectés à votre application avec Facebook et ont accordé les autorisations nécessaires.
  9. Question: Comment puis-je m'assurer que mon application est conforme aux réglementations en matière de protection des données telles que le RGPD ?
  10. Répondre: Mettez en œuvre des pratiques transparentes de traitement des données, obtenez un consentement clair pour la collecte de données et offrez aux utilisateurs le contrôle de leurs données. Consultez un expert juridique pour garantir une conformité totale.

Maîtriser la passerelle de données de Facebook

Plonger dans le domaine de l'API Facebook Graph pour la récupération d'e-mails illustre l'interaction complexe entre l'innovation et la confidentialité des utilisateurs. Alors que les développeurs se lancent dans cette aventure, ils sont confrontés au double défi d'adhérer au paysage changeant des API de Facebook et de naviguer dans le domaine plus large des lois sur la protection des données. Le processus n’est pas seulement technique mais profondément ancré dans des considérations éthiques, mettant l’accent sur la nécessité de transparence, de consentement et de respect des données des utilisateurs. L'intégration réussie de ces éléments améliore non seulement la fonctionnalité de l'application, mais renforce également la confiance avec les utilisateurs, favorisant ainsi un environnement numérique plus connecté et plus respectueux. À mesure que nous avançons, les leçons tirées de l'engagement avec des plateformes telles que l'API Graph de Facebook servent de modèles précieux pour l'avenir du développement d'applications dans un monde de plus en plus soucieux des données.